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/user-interface/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Scheme 方案-列表中的值_Scheme - Fatal编程技术网

Scheme 方案-列表中的值

Scheme 方案-列表中的值,scheme,Scheme,我有一份清单: ((1500)(2500)(3500)) 现在,我想使用每个列表中的值。当我这样做(carlist)时,它会给我(1500)-list,但我想要值1500(int) 我怎么做 谢谢你 您需要包含1500的列表中的car,该值将为 比如: (car (car '((1500)(2500)(3500)))) 这对于第一个值就足够了。正如拉斯曼指出的那样,还有其他方法可以获得所有其他值。caar也可以用较少的参数获得相同的值。 > (apply append '((1500)

我有一份清单:

((1500)(2500)(3500))

现在,我想使用每个列表中的值。当我这样做(carlist)时,它会给我(1500)-list,但我想要值1500(int)

我怎么做


谢谢你

您需要包含1500的列表中的
car
,该值将为

比如:

(car (car '((1500)(2500)(3500))))

这对于第一个值就足够了。正如拉斯曼指出的那样,还有其他方法可以获得所有其他值。

caar
也可以用较少的参数获得相同的值。
> (apply append '((1500) (2500) (3500)))
(1500 2500 3500)
> (map car '((1500) (2500) (3500)))
(1500 2000 3)